Information about a set of Amazon ECS tasks in either an AWS CodeDeploy or an EXTERNAL
deployment. An
Amazon ECS task set includes details such as the desired number of tasks, how many tasks are running, and whether the
task set serves production traffic.

- The Amazon Resource Name (ARN) of the cluster that the service that hosts the task set exists in.public void setStartedBy(String startedBy)
The tag specified when a task set is started. If the task set is created by an AWS CodeDeploy deployment, the
startedBy
parameter is CODE_DEPLOY
. For a task set created for an external deployment,
the startedBy field isn't used.

deployment, the startedBy field isn't used.public void setExternalId(String externalId)
The external ID associated with the task set.
If a task set is created by an AWS CodeDeploy deployment, the externalId
parameter contains the AWS
CodeDeploy deployment ID.
If a task set is created for an external deployment and is associated with a service discovery registry, the
externalId
parameter contains the ECS_TASK_SET_EXTERNAL_ID
AWS Cloud Map attribute.

- The task definition the task set is using.public void setComputedDesiredCount(Integer computedDesiredCount)
The computed desired count for the task set. This is calculated by multiplying the service's
desiredCount
by the task set's scale
percentage. The result is always rounded up. For
example, if the computed desired count is 1.2, it rounds up to 2 tasks.

up. For example, if the computed desired count is 1.2, it rounds up to 2 tasks.public void setPendingCount(Integer pendingCount)
The number of tasks in the task set that are in the PENDING
status during a deployment. A task in
the PENDING
state is preparing to enter the RUNNING
state. A task set enters the
PENDING
status when it launches for the first time or when it is restarted after being in the
STOPPED
state.

public void setPlatformVersion(String platformVersion)
The platform version on which the tasks in the task set are running. A platform version is only specified for
tasks using the Fargate launch type. If one is not specified, the LATEST
platform version is used by
default. For more information, see AWS Fargate Platform
Versions in the Amazon Elastic Container Service Developer Guide.

- A floating-point percentage of the desired number of tasks to place and keep running in the task set.public void setStabilityStatus(String stabilityStatus)
The stability status, which indicates whether the task set has reached a steady state. If the following
conditions are met, the task set will be in STEADY_STATE
:
The task runningCount
is equal to the computedDesiredCount
.
The pendingCount
is 0
.
There are no tasks running on container instances in the DRAINING
status.
All tasks are reporting a healthy status from the load balancers, service discovery, and container health checks.
If a healthCheckGracePeriodSeconds
value was set when the service was created, you may see a
STEADY_STATE
reached since unhealthy Elastic Load Balancing target health checks will be ignored
until it expires.
If any of those conditions are not met, the stability status returns STABILIZING
.
